אילו שפות נתמכות על ידי תוכנת מכונת עיבוד הלייזר של המראה החכם?
מבוא למכונות עיבוד הלייזר של המראה החכם
מכונות עיבוד הלייזר של המראה החכם זכו לתשומת לב רבה בתעשיות שונות, במיוחד בייצור ובעיצוב. מכונות מתקדמות אלו משתמשות בתוכנה מתקדמת כדי להקל על מגוון יישומים, מעיבוד ועד חיתוך. אחד הגורמים הקריטיים שקובעים את הרבגוניות שלהן הוא שפות התכנות הנתמכות על ידי התוכנה.
שפות תכנות נתמכות
התוכנה של מכונות עיבוד הלייזר של המראה החכם בנויה להיות עמידה וגמישה, ומאפשרת למשתמשים לנצל שפות תכנות שונות. להלן כמה מהשפות העיקריות הנתמכות:
- C++: ידועה בביצועים וביעילות שלה, C++ משמשת בדרך כלל לפיתוח יישומים בעלי ביצועים גבוהים, מה שהופך אותה לאידיאלית לשליטה במערכות לייזר.
- Python: עם הפשטות והקריאות שלה, Python הפכה לשפת הבחירה עבור רבים מהמשתמשים, במיוחד עבור אלו שמתחילים בתכנות. הספריות הרחבות שלה גם מקלות על פיתוח מהיר.
- JavaScript: משמשת לעיתים קרובות ליישומי אינטרנט, JavaScript גם מועילה בתוכנת עיבוד הלייזר, במיוחד ליצירת ממשקי משתמש שמשפרים את חוויית המשתמש.
- G-code: זו השפה הסטנדרטית למכונות CNC, כולל חותכי לייזר. היא מספקת הוראות מדויקות למכונה, ומבטיחה עיבוד מדויק.
- Lua: שפת סקריפט קלה, לואה משולבת לעיתים קרובות בתוכנות לעיבוד בלייזר למשימות התאמה ואוטומציה.
שילוב עם טכנולוגיות אחרות
תכונה מרכזית של מכונות עיבוד הלייזר של המראה החכם היא היכולת שלהן להשתלב עם טכנולוגיות אחרות. אינטגרציה זו מתבצעת בעיקר על ידי שפות התכנות שהוזכרו לעיל. לדוגמה, מערכות רבות מאפשרות למשתמשים ליצור סקריפטים ב-Python שיכולים לאוטומט משימות חוזרות, ובכך להגדיל את היעילות. בנוסף, היכולת להשתמש ב-JavaScript לפיתוח צד לקוח מאפשרת למשתמשים לתקשר עם המכונה בזמן אמת, ולהתאים פרמטרים מבלי להזדקק להיכנס לעמקי הקוד האחורי.
התאמה אישית והעדפות משתמש
התאמה אישית היא יתרון משמעותי כאשר מדובר במכונות עיבוד הלייזר של המראה החכם. בהתאם לצרכים הספציפיים של המשתמש או הארגון, ניתן לנצל שפות תכנות שונות כדי ליצור פתרונות מותאמים. לדוגמה, מעצב עשוי להעדיף את Python בשל קלות השימוש שלה, בעוד מהנדס עשוי לבחור ב-C++ בזכות יכולות הביצועים שלה.
בנוסף, הקהילה של המשתמשים סביב מכונות אלו תורמת לעיתים קרובות לפיתוח תוספים או סקריפטים שמחמיאים על הפונקציונליות הבסיסית. גישה זו המנוהלת על ידי הקהילה לא רק מעודדת חדשנות אלא גם מספקת שפע של משאבים לפתרון בעיות ואופטימיזציה של ביצועים.
אתגרים ושיקולים
בעוד שהמגוון של שפות התכנות הנתמכות מציע גמישות, הוא גם מציב כמה אתגרים. למשתמשים חייב להיות רמה מסוימת של מיומנות באחת או יותר משפות אלו כדי לנצל במלואן את יכולות מכונות עיבוד הלייזר. בנוסף, עשויות להיות הבדלים משמעותיים באופן שבו שפות אלו מתקשרות עם החומרה של המכונה, מה שעשוי לדרוש ידע מיוחד.
יתרה מכך, בעיות תאימות עשויות להתעורר כאשר משולבים תוכנות או ספריות של צד שלישי. זה חיוני עבור משתמשים להישאר מעודכנים על ההתפתחויות האחרונות הן בשפות התכנות והן בטכנולוגיית עיבוד הלייזר. לדוגמה, עדכונים רגילים מיצרנים כמו פרולוגיס יכולים לספק תובנות קריטיות על תכונות חדשות או שיפורים שמחמיאים על חוויית המשתמש.
מגמות עתידיות בתמיכה בשפות
כשהטכנולוגיה ממשיכה להתפתח, אנו יכולים לצפות לראות התקדמויות נוספות בשפות התכנות הנתמכות על ידי מכונות עיבוד הלייזר של המראה החכם. המגמה לעבר למידת מכונה ובינה מלאכותית עשויה להוביל לשילוב של שפות כמו R או אפילו שפות מיוחדות המיועדות ליישומי AI.
בנוסף, ככל שהביקוש לממשקי משתמש ידידותיים גובר, תוכנה עתידית עשויה להעדיף שפות שמחמיאות על פיתוח ממשקי משתמש גרפיים (GUI), מה שמקל על משתמשים שאינם מתכנתים להפעיל את המכונות המתקדמות הללו.
סיכום
הבחירה בשפת תכנות בתוכנת מכונת עיבוד הלייזר של המראה החכם משחקת תפקיד קריטי בפונקציונליות ובחוויית המשתמש שלה. הבנת החוזקות והמגבלות של כל שפה נתמכת יכולה להעצים את המשתמשים לקבל החלטות מושכלות, לשפר את הפרודוקטיביות והיצירתיות שלהם ביישומי עיבוד הלייזר.
